1. 程式人生 > >Zookeeper例項ZkClient API-建立節點

Zookeeper例項ZkClient API-建立節點

import org.I0Itec.zkclient.ZkClient;

/**
 * 
* @ClassName: Create_Node_Sample 
* @Description: TODO(使用ZkClient建立節點) 
* @author 
* @date 2017年6月14日 下午12:49:54 
*
 */
public class Create_Node_Sample {

    public static void main(String[] args) throws Exception {
    	ZkClient zkClient = new ZkClient("localhost:2181", 5000);
        String path = "/zk-book/c1";
        zkClient.createPersistent(path, true);
    }
}

注意:

ZkClient提供了較多的建立節點API介面,其中不同的地方是可以傳遞物件,和原生的Zookeeper不同。ZkClient通過createParents這個引數,ZkClient能夠在內部幫助我們遞迴建立父節點。


擴充套件



參考

1.《從Paxos到Zookeeper:分散式一致性原理與實踐》